Define the Foreign Exchange Market Demand Curve Slope

The foreign exchange market demand curve slope measures the relationship between the exchange rate and the quantity of currency demanded. It shows how the quantity of currency demanded changes as the exchange rate changes.

Relationship between Exchange Rate and Quantity Demanded, Foreign exchange market demand curve slope

The exchange rate is the price of one currency in terms of another currency. The quantity of currency demanded is the amount of currency that people are willing and able to buy at a given exchange rate.

The demand curve for foreign exchange is typically downward sloping, meaning that as the exchange rate increases, the quantity of currency demanded decreases. This is because as the exchange rate increases, it becomes more expensive to buy foreign currency, so people will demand less of it.

Factors Affecting the Foreign Exchange Market Demand Curve Slope

The slope of the foreign exchange market demand curve is influenced by various economic factors that affect the demand for foreign currencies. These factors can cause the demand curve to shift to the right or left, indicating changes in the demand for foreign exchange.

Exchange Rate Expectations

Expectations about future exchange rates significantly impact the demand for foreign currencies. If market participants anticipate that a currency will appreciate in value, they tend to increase their demand for that currency, leading to a rightward shift in the demand curve. Conversely, if they expect a currency to depreciate, demand decreases, causing a leftward shift.

Interest Rate Differentials

Differences in interest rates between countries affect the demand for foreign currencies. When a country offers higher interest rates compared to others, it attracts foreign investors seeking higher returns on their investments. This increased demand for the country’s currency leads to a rightward shift in the demand curve.

Economic Growth and Inflation

Economic growth and inflation rates influence the demand for foreign currencies. A country experiencing strong economic growth and low inflation tends to attract foreign investment, leading to increased demand for its currency and a rightward shift in the demand curve. Conversely, a country with slow economic growth and high inflation may experience reduced demand for its currency, causing a leftward shift.

Political and Economic Stability

Political and economic stability plays a crucial role in determining the demand for a country’s currency. Investors prefer currencies from countries with stable political and economic environments, as they perceive these currencies as less risky. Increased demand for these currencies leads to a rightward shift in the demand curve.

Hedging Strategies

Given the impact of exchange rate fluctuations, businesses and investors can employ various hedging strategies to mitigate foreign exchange risk. These strategies involve using financial instruments to offset potential losses or gains arising from currency movements.

  • Forward Contracts: Businesses can enter into forward contracts to lock in an exchange rate for a future transaction, protecting themselves from adverse exchange rate movements.
  • Currency Options: Currency options provide businesses with the flexibility to buy or sell a currency at a specified exchange rate within a certain period. This allows them to limit potential losses while still benefiting from favorable exchange rate movements.
  • Currency Swaps: Currency swaps involve exchanging one currency for another at a predetermined exchange rate for a specified period. They are commonly used to manage long-term foreign exchange exposure.
